Overview of Drop-in Daycare:
Drop-in daycare centers supply short-term childcare services for parents who need periodic or last-minute maintain kids. These services typically run on a pay-as-you-go basis, permitting moms and dads to use the solutions only once needed minus the commitment of a long-term contract. Drop-in daycare facilities can offer a number of programs and tasks for kids of various many years, including playtime, educational activities, and meals.
Benefits of Drop-in Daycare:
There are numerous advantageous assets to making use of drop-in daycare solutions both for parents and kids. For moms and dads, the flexibleness of drop-in daycare allows all of them to set up childcare around their work or other commitments with no need for a regular childcare arrangement. This can be especially helpful for moms and dads just who work unusual hours or have unpredictable schedules. Drop-in daycare in addition provides a convenient selection for moms and dads which may require childcare on brief notice or perhaps in disaster situations.
For the kids, drop-in daycare can offer a secure and stimulating environment where they could socialize with other kids and practice age-appropriate tasks. It will help kids develop personal skills, develop self-confidence, and find out new things while their parents are away. Drop-in daycare facilities may also provide educational programs which will help children discover and develop in a fun and appealing way.
Considerations for Choosing a Drop-in Daycare Facility:
When selecting a drop-in daycare center for his or her children, parents should consider several elements to ensure they're picking a secure and dependable option. Some crucial considerations include the location and hours of operation of center, the skills and connection with the staff, the cleanliness and safety of center, in addition to activities and programs provided for kids. Parents may also desire to think about the cost of drop-in daycare solutions and any extra charges or requirements that may apply.
